Frequently Asked Questions about the 90038 ZIP Code

What is the current pricing and availability for apartments for rent in the 90038 ZIP Code?

As of today, July 26, 2026, there are currently 1,106 available 90038 apartments priced from $1,097 to $8,250, with an average monthly rent of $2,993.

How much are Studio apartments in 90038?

There are currently 581 Studio Apartments in 90038 with rent ranges from $1,097 to $3,140 with an average price of $1,872.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om 90038 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 90038 ranges from $1,334 to $4,950 with an average monthly rent of $2,547.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 90038 c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 90038 range from $2,045 to $8,250.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,660.

How expensive are 90038 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 126 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 90038 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,750 to $7,129 - averaging $4,168 for the location.
